The Bengal cat is a relatively new breed, descended from a cross between an Asian Leopard Cat and any of several domestic breeds, including Shorthairs or Maus. The variations in markings include leopard-like spots or flowing marble patterns. The colors of Bengals can range from creamy white with tan markings to tawny brown with black markings and, more recently, "silvers." There is also the occasional black on black. These are magnificent animals and make loving, energetic pets.
